FAISALABAD: Two teenagers were allegedly killed during an encounter with Millat Town police on Wednesday night.

Millat Town Police Station SHO Syed Imtiaz Hussain said two motorcyclists were signalled to stop by a police team headed by police. However, instead of stopping, they opened fire and sped away which forced the police to retaliate, he claimed.

As a result, both the young men, later identified as Usman and Arsalan, were seriously injured and died at hospital. Police also reportedly recovered a pistol found in their possession.

On the other hand, the parents and relatives of the two boys gathered outside Allied Hospital and protested against the police. They maintained that the police shot the boys without any justification.

Meanwhile, Faisalabad RPO Ghulam Muhammad Dogar took notice of the incident and directed the CPO to investigate the matter and submit a report within 24 hours.
